Honors on Exchange
One of the very best ways to broaden and enrich your college education is to study abroad. Honors Program students are encouraged to work with UAF's Office of International Programs if they are interested in spending a semester abroad.
In many cases, upper level credit hours or credits within your major earned during your semester abroad can be transferred and applied towards your Honors graduation credit requirement. Following your semester abroad, you will meet with Kerrie Dufseth to discuss grade transfer, and to set up an appointment for a short 15 minute presentation to your peers and campus notables about your time on exchange. The Honors on Exchange Presentations have become a fun staple in the academic year open to the campus.
